Predicted Aston Villa side to play Norwich: Hogan should return to starting line-up

Here is how we predict Aston Villa and Norwich City will line up this weekend:

To be played on Saturday 1st April 2017 at 14:00. Venue: Villa Park, Birmingham

Odds: Aston Villa 13/10, Draw 11/5, Norwich 15/8

Aston Villa welcome Norwich City to Villa Park this weekend for their first Championship match after the latest international break.

After a shaky start under new manager Steve Bruce, Villa are now very much on the up and will be hoping to add another three points to their tally on Saturday.

It will not be easy against a Norwich side that has not given up hope of securing a play-off place between now and May, even if they are currently five points below sixth-placed Sheffield Wednesday with time running out.

A win for Villa could take them into the top 10 for the first time in a long time and while a promotion push of their own is beyond them this season, a good end to the campaign will give them confidence heading into next year.

With that in mind here is how we expect Villa and Norwich to line up on Saturday afternoon:

Aston Villa predicted lineup

  • Sam Johnstone
  • Jordan Amavi
  • James Chester
  • Alan Hutton
  • Albert Adomah
  • James Bree
  • Conor Hourihane
  • Mile Jedinak
  • Henri Lansbury
  • Scott Hogan
  • Jonathan Kodjia

Norwich predicted lineup

  • Michael McGovern
  • Ryan Bennett
  • Ivo Pinto
  • Russell Martin
  • Steven Whittaker
  • Wes Hoolahan
  • Jonny Howson
  • Alex Pritchard
  • Alexander Tettey
  • Cameron Jerome
  • Josh Murphy
